Don't understand this formula at all. How does an undefeated LP team beat Bingham by 21 points and still have a lower rating? Not that it matters at all, I'm just not sure how it works. For example LP averages more points than Bingham, gives up fewer, beat them head to head, and just won by 45 points in the playoffs. Not adding up. Anyone have any idea how this is calculated?
Google Parry's Power Guide and you will find their website with this explanation:
The purpose of the guide is to show the strength of a team in relation to other teams in the league. Each teams rating consists of two factors; an offensive rating and a defensive rating. The offensive rating is based on final score and the defensive rating is based on strength of schedule. The combination of these two ratings establishes a power rating for that team. When you compare the ratings of the two teams that play each other, you can determine who is favored by how many points.
The ratings are updated weekly, by computer, based on a formula created by Noland Parry.

It is only numbers if you look at some of his picks even he goes against the numbers. Binghams rating comes from points scored and points scored against since they played alot of the same teams here are a few examples:
Bingham 35, American Fork 7 / Bingham 49, Lehi 0 / Bingham 41, Pleasant Grove 0
Lone Peak 49, American Fork 7/Lone Peak 52, Lehi 20/Lone Peak 17,Pleasant Grove 0
Strength of schedule and scores in Lehi and PG make the differance. Bingham beat Alta but later had a lower ranking than Alta.
